removeSessionVariables: Remove variables from a client session environment

Description

This function removes variables from the environment of a client session. It allows, for instance, to unmask a variable with the same name from the outer app environment (see setEnvironment) for the session (check the example below). This function is a wrapper around method sessionVariables of the class Session.

Usage

removeSessionVariables(varNames, sessionId = NULL)

Arguments

varNames

Names of variables to remove.

sessionId

ID of the session. If there is only one active session, this argument becomes optional.

Examples

Run this code
# NOT RUN {
openPage(allowedVariables = "k", sessionVars = list(k = 10))

k <- -1
getPage()$openPage(FALSE)
id1 <- getSessionIds()[1]
id2 <- getSessionIds()[2]
removeSessionVariables("k", id1)
#this changes global 'k', since the variable is no longer masked
sendCommand("jrc.sendData('k', 1)", sessionId = id1, wait = 3)
#this doesn't affect global 'k'
sendCommand("jrc.sendData('k', 5)", sessionId = id2, wait = 3)
local_k <- getSessionVariable("k", id2)

closePage()
# }
